    I don’t see the point in paying for this sort of software when 7-Zip offers AES-256 encryption for free.. always… and is widely supported as a compression tool too. Why bother with proprietary software package from companies no-ones ever heard of!? Just my opinion of course.

    I like this program because it is indeed easy to use ,but there seems to be new guidelines or instructions on producing encryption programs, none of them are as safe as they claim to be including this one, another newcommer , any encryption program that tells you that you or they can retrieve a lost or forgotten password is flawed and NOT safe because it means that your password is in the header or somewhere in the encrypted file and can be retrieved by anyone with the time know how resources and brains ,using good encrypting programs comes with the implied risk that should you lost or forget your carefully chosen strong password means good bye to your files or folders.This programs warns you to be careful about changing your password because doing so will delete all files created with the old password and thats just the password not the key it made so once your password is collected out of the encrypted file both your files and private key is open to be examined . Take your time and decide .
